Larbert train station is nestled in the heart of the charming town of Larbert in Scotland. Whether you're a daily commuter, a weekend adventurer, or just someone passing through, Larbert station offers a convenient and accessible gateway to many destinations. Known for its quiet surroundings and easy access, this station is a great starting point for your travels across Scotland and beyond.
Larbert station makes your travel experience straightforward and hassle-free with its vital facilities. The ticket office is open from 07:00 to 20:54 every day of the week except Sunday, ensuring you have ample time to handle your ticketing needs. Ticket machines are readily available, and they are equipped with induction loops for the hearing impaired, making ticket services both friendly and accessible. While modern conveniences like smartcard issuing are not available, there are smartcard validators for easy travel.
Larbert is more than just a pitstop — it's a hub brimming with onward travel options. Visitors can conveniently access local and regional bus services, with detailed schedules available at Traveline Scotland. For those seeking personalized travel options, taxi services can be arranged through Train Taxi. If you're in need of a ride, rest assured knowing the station’s car park facilitates easy drop-off and pick-up without any parking fees.
Welcome to a space that endeavors to provide access to all. The station features step-free access on some parts and ramps for train access to help those with mobility impairments. Although there are no accessible toilets and dedicated accessible taxis, Passenger Assist services can be arranged for those requiring additional help, ensuring every traveler feels accommodated.
Thanks to its strategic positioning on the Scottish rail network, Larbert provides travelers with a plethora of attractive destinations. Fancy a vibrant city vibe? Hop on for a quick trip to Glasgow Queen Street or head to the cultural capital with a journey to Edinburgh. Stirling, a stone’s throw away, is accessible via the Stirling service. Further afield, enjoy direct routes to scenic locales such as Dundee and join the bustling crowd at London Kings Cross.
Before you embark on your travels from Larbert station, it's worth considering the unique features and services on offer. Although there's no public Wi-Fi or refreshment facilities on-site, ensuring you're prepped for your journey can alleviate potential nuisances. For visitors keen on cycling, the station includes bicycle storage with 14 spaces and sheltered options.

Welcome to Bedford Railway Station, a bustling hub located in the historic town of Bedfordshire. Known for its connections to major destinations and its prominent role in local transport, Bedford Station provides a vital link for daily commuters and travelers exploring the UK. If you’re planning a journey from Bedford, you’re in the right place to gather all the necessary information for a smooth start to your trip.
At Bedford Station, you'll find a range of facilities designed to make your travel experience as comfortable and convenient as possible. The ticket office is open every day, with hours extending from early morning to late evening, ensuring you can pick up your tickets easily. Automated ticket machines are available, providing the option to collect tickets purchased online.
The station is well-equipped to support travelers with accessibility needs. Step-free access is provided across all platforms, and accessible ticket machines accommodate those with the Disabled Persons Railcard. Though there’s no designated waiting room, the seating area ensures comfort while you wait for your train. For added convenience, an induction loop is available for those who require it.
Once you've reached Bedford, continuing your journey is straightforward with a variety of transport links. A taxi rank is conveniently located at the front of the station, allowing for easy and quick access to local areas. Looking to plan your journey by bus? There’s an onward travel information map to help with your plans. Should there be service disruptions, detailed information on rail replacement bus services is available to ensure you're never caught off guard.
Whether you're commuting for work or planning a leisure trip, Bedford Station offers seamless connections to numerous destinations. Popular routes include journeys to bustling London destinations such as St Pancras International, London Bridge, and London Blackfriars. Other convenient routes include travel to nearby towns like Luton, Flitwick, and Wellingborough. For those flying out, connections like Luton Airport Parkway are perfect for catching your next flight.
For a bit further afield, routes to Brighton and Nottingham are also available, offering an abundance of options no matter your destination.
